Hachioji Yume Art Museum
Museum in The Musashino, Tama area
Hachioji Yume Art Museum opened in October of 2003 on the 2nd floor of View Tower Hachioji as a museum for the local community. Despite its small size, the museum holds six special exhibitions a year in addition to its all-year permanent collection. Workshops, lectures, and other opportunities for learning are also offered. The aim of the museum is to provide a place where the local community can enjoy art as a part of daily life.
